Video Games
Hitman: World of Assassination Free Starter Pack
So, the developers of this have made the new James Bond game, First Light, which naturally I'm looking forward to; and this game is widely acclaimed (PC Gamer regularly include it in the top half of their annual top games list), even though I didn't think it was really my kind of thing; but it has a free demo on Steam, so I thought "why not? You never know."
Well, what Steam calls a "demo" the game calls a "starter pack" — it makes you install the full thing, all 60-something GB of it. I guess the idea is you'll love it soooo much you just have to upgrade immediately. I spent 10+ minutes trying to log in online, because you have to before you can actually play anything, and it's not implemented in a Steam Deck friendly way so it took undue effort. But I persevered. Then I had to work out where the hell the actual demo/starter content was — not as clear as you'd think, because you've installed the full game, which after years of support seems to have a tonne of stuff on offer (they're still releasing new content for it regularly). But I found where I had to go eventually.
And then I got killed trying to do the fucking training mission.
I could've had another go at it, of course, but I hadn't really been enjoying it up to that point anyway, so why bother? I was right the first time: this is not a game for me. I hope I enjoy First Light more.
